Kagan MacTane on Nostr: Reminder for anyone handling names in a form, database, or whatever: both given names ...
Reminder for anyone handling names in a form, database, or whatever: both given names and surnames can have spaces in them. "Mary Ann" is a valid name, and "St. Clair" is a real family name. Allow your users to put in their names properly, and *never* call them "invalid".
(What's actually invalid if you do that is *your name validation logic*.)
#webdev #WebDevelopment #BadUX #BadUXDesign #UX #UI #names
Published at
2024-06-14 18:32:39Event JSON
{
"id": "2cf35fb9ee54addb03eee769d73ea00e2b09f9bc7e59570f9b88125b2cf4090f",
"pubkey": "4faf0628f38dfb9f151478a8f48ca9c34f9a9e5377f9be98d624c4f4e31fdfe2",
"created_at": 1718389959,
"kind": 1,
"tags": [
[
"t",
"webdev"
],
[
"t",
"webdevelopment"
],
[
"t",
"badux"
],
[
"t",
"baduxdesign"
],
[
"t",
"ux"
],
[
"t",
"ui"
],
[
"t",
"names"
],
[
"proxy",
"https://wandering.shop/users/kagan/statuses/112616404355260081",
"activitypub"
]
],
"content": "Reminder for anyone handling names in a form, database, or whatever: both given names and surnames can have spaces in them. \"Mary Ann\" is a valid name, and \"St. Clair\" is a real family name. Allow your users to put in their names properly, and *never* call them \"invalid\".\n\n(What's actually invalid if you do that is *your name validation logic*.)\n\n#webdev #WebDevelopment #BadUX #BadUXDesign #UX #UI #names",
"sig": "ed3791042f3268cce2f266f7d46aa72c7319ea3c7ec553a4eb622295470547c2fbe3f4a66970ceed7f6d8d3070df581888b37183c4c2b1ef95689dd0fac53a61"
}